What are the benefits of a class action lawsuit?

A class action lawsuit is a way for individuals with similar complaints or interests to join together to seek justice and compensation from a single lawsuit. This allows people to file a lawsuit against the same defendant on behalf of a large group of individuals, rather than having to prepare separate lawsuits for each person. In West Virginia, class action lawsuits offer a number of benefits to those who choose to participate. The primary benefit of a class action lawsuit is that it costs much less to file than would multiple individual lawsuits against the same defendant in West Virginia. Additionally, it spreads the financial risk of litigation amongst the group, as the entire class of individuals can split the costs associated with filing and litigating the case. This allows those with smaller claims to pursue justice through a class action that would not be financially feasible through individual lawsuits. Another benefit of filing a class action lawsuit in West Virginia is that it increases the chances of success. The sheer number of plaintiffs brings more attention to the case and makes it much more difficult for the defendant to successfully argue against the collective arguments made by the class. A class action suit can also be utilized to force policy changes in the defendant’s business practices to prevent similar claims from being made in the future. Through class action lawsuits, individuals who otherwise would not be able to afford legal representation can seek justice in West Virginia. They can seek benefits such as a recovery of damages, a stop to illegal practices, or a change in policy to prevent future harms. These benefits, along with the collective power of the group, make class action lawsuits a viable option for groups pursuing justice in West Virginia.
